Synonyms for “revert”

revert

verb

  1. go back, return, come back, resume, lapse, recur, relapse, regress, backslide, take up where you left off • He reverted to smoking heavily.
  2. return, go back to, be returned to, be once again in the possession of • The property reverts to the freeholder.
    Since the concept back is already contained in the re- part of the word revert, it is unnecessary to say that someone reverts back to a particular type of behaviour.

  • British English: revert When people or things revert to a previous state, system, or type of behaviour, they go back to it. VERBThe area was farmland until 1970 but has reverted to woodland since.
